On January 14th, the FBI raided a Washington Post reporter's home. They seized her phone, laptops, and watch. The warrant included a section titled "Biometric Unlock", authorizing agents to use her face and fingers to access her devices. They found she had 1,100+ sources on Signal.
Built a free opensource macOS app this week. It's called PanicLock. One click (or keyboard shortcut) instantly disables Touch ID and locks your Mac. Password required to get back in. Why? Because of what happened to Hannah Natanson. paniclock.github.io
